Key Hardline Goods Inspection Services We Provide

Our support is structured around the production checkpoints where product quality, shipment readiness, and buyer protection become most visible.

Initial Production Check

We review raw materials, approved standards, and early production readiness before hardline goods output scales up.

During Production Inspection

We inspect while goods are in production so assembly, finish, structural, and packaging issues can be identified sooner.

Final Random Inspection

Finished goods are reviewed for appearance, workmanship, functionality, labeling, packing quality, and shipment readiness.

Container Loading Supervision

We monitor the loading process to help confirm quantity, carton condition, and shipment handling before dispatch.

Factory-Based Sample Picking

Samples are selected directly from production so buyers can review a more realistic picture of hardline goods quality.

AQL-Based Quality Evaluation

Inspection findings are structured around accepted quality limits to support clearer shipment decisions and tighter control.
